Introduction
Berger is one of the largest paint manufacturing company and one of the well
growing paint company in Pakistan since its inception from 1950.Despite many
challenges, Berger Paints has succeeded in staying at the forefront of Pakistans
paint.
The strategic management of Berger paint is given below

Vision

We will become the leading paints and associated products manufacturing and
marketing company in Pakistan ensuring best returns to our investors & highest
customer satisfaction.

Mission

A summarized mission of Berger paints is;


We will lead by innovation, commitment to achieve best quality products and
services, safeguard the interests all other stakeholders, act as a good corporate
citizen ensuring service towards community and shall focus on environment,
health and safety.

Objective

The company utilizes all available resources to pursue its EHS (Health, Safety &
Environment) objectives by striving to attain economic prosperity and ecological
balance.

Corporate Governance
BERGER PAINTS PAKISTAN became a public limited company in 1974.At present it
has 7 board of director in which Mr. Maqbool H.H. Rahimtoola is the chairman and Dr.
Mahmood Ahmad is the chief executive

Roles of board of director

Berger paints has nominal participation of the board of director with limited
degree of involvement in reviewing the performance or review of key decision and

program of management. The role is widely occupied by CEO and its management
team. However the key decision is made by board of director.

Societal Environment
Health, Safety & Environment
Special focus is placed at Berger on protection of the environment as well as
health and safety of employees, customers and communities where it operates.

The company utilizes all available resources to pursue its EHS objectives by
striving to attain economic prosperity and ecological balance.
Berger manufacturing facility conforms to the international and national
environmental standards where company is manufacturing environmental
friendly products to minimize the potential effect on the people and the
environment.
A clean and pollution-free environment is ensured at the companys
manufacturing facilities through a Solvent Recovery Plant that recycles used
solvent, a Dust/Vapor extraction system and a Xylene recovery system.
Safety training programs are organized on a regular basis for all personnel
and factory workers and vendors to ensure safety of the work environment.
Strict safety regulations for PPEs (Personal Protection Equipments) and work
procedures are enforced at every step .In addition, safety officers conduct regular
Safety Audits that identify and rectify any non-compliance and enforce proper
maintenance of safety procedures with active cooperation of all employees.

TECHNOLOGICAL

Trends in technology such as new equipment related to paints, using robotic


technology , using computing power i.e. is developing customer database ,e
commerce , understanding energy crises in Pakistan thus developing alternative
energy sources etc. are some of the issues that paint industry faces. That is why
Berger paints has entered into a number of technical alliance arrangements with
leading international manufacturers in paints industry. These include the wellknown paint company in Japan which enables them to develop Automobile paints,
UK for Powder Coatings, Malaysia for markings of Road & Runway etc. The Berger
paints is also committed to continuous process of investment in new equipment
e.g. computerized matching color technology. Collaboration is also going on with

Dura Cromix for car paint and Nippon for latest technology i.e. environmental
friendly how because scientifically it is proved that led emit fumes i.e. is injurious
to health.

Task environmentWhile scanning the task environment, Supplier Public, Intermediaries and
Customer Market (SPICC) help in better understanding of task environment.

Supplier

Raw material is supplied from UAE and reaches Lahore from where it is supplied to
other city main warehouses; however every city has it on distributor chain. In
supplying to market the intermediary channel is used while in case of Business to
Business (B2B) selling the paint is directly supplied to the B2B customer.

Public

Across all layers in the Berger paints, it is encouraging an environment of


recognizing talent, fostering potential and encourages initiatives. Berger paint is
maintaining an environment enabling freedom, fairness and equal opportunity to
perform and excel with in situations.
NFEH (National Forum for Environment & Health) recognized Berger for its
activities done in respect of corporate social responsibility (CSR) and beautiful
conference was held in Islamabad where Berger was awarded Corporate Social
Responsibility (CSR) Award 2015

Intermediaries

Shah distributer act as an intermediary to supply product to the market in


Islamabad however every city has its own intermediary channel. But in Business
to Business (B2B)Berger paints supply itself to the customer because buying it
from market it will be more expensive for them as compare to dealing directly,
similarly the commission given to intermediary is also saved for Berger paint in
selling Business to Business (B2B)

Competitor

List of competitor is long including local company but because its brand image is
high thus competitor who compete include AkzoNobel Pakistan, ICI, deluxe bright
etc
However In a conversation on 11 December 2015 sales officer M.
Meraaj confirmed that AkzoNobel is leader in market while Berger is second to it.
The reason behind it is that fire evoked in Karachi head quarter that burn billion of
stuff.

Prospectors
Berger paint follow prospector type strategy i.e. fairly comprehensive product
lines that focus on market opportunities and product innovation. They tend to
emphasize efficiency along with creativity .E.g. as an innovative and progressive
paint company, Berger Paints Pakistan offers a wide range of paints for diverse
applications and uses .Berger has eleven product line Decorative Business,
Automotive Business, General Industrial Finisher, Powder Coating, Protective
Coatings etc.
